WebThe Hydroponics Monitoring System (HMS) is an embedded system designed to assist in the monitoring of plant growth. The system uses a Raspberry Pi at its core, and features a controllable pump, pH sensor, and ppm sensor which allow for the user to easily understand the state of the hydroponics enclosure. WebMonitoring Electrical Conductivity for Hydroponics Hydroponic nutrient solutions are made of mineral salts dissolved in water. The strength of the nutrient solution can be detected by monitoring the electrical conductivity (EC). Higher EC values indicate higher ionic (salt) concentrations. WebHydroponics. Web12 dec. 2024 · pH Test Kits. Using a pH test kit will allow you to monitor the levels of acidity and alkalinity in your hydroponic system. If pH is off, it means that other aspects like nutrient strength will be too. pH test kits are cheap and simple to use, but they're also very accurate.
